Carolyn Hart

An accomplished master of mystery with 39 published books, Carolyn Hart is the creator of the highly acclaimed Henrie O and Death on Demand series. Her books have won multiple Agatha, Anthony, and Macavity Awards. Letter from Home (2003), her standalone mystery set in Oklahoma, was nominated for the Pulitzer Prize. Her latest book is Set Sail for Murder (William Morrow/HarperCollins, 2007). She is one of the founders of Sisters in Crime, an organization for women who write mysteries. She lives in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ma.
